Hello. I just purchased the PM plugin for WPforo.
 
In the PM box when I type there is a space after the paragraph, but when I sent it space is lost.
 
Any ideas on this?
 
See attached sample of text when typing, then what it looks like when sent.
 
I checked the back end and there is a <p> code after each return.
 
I am using Enfold and WP 5.7.

@jason-toth,

The editor and the message list are different environments with different CSS style rules for paragraphs. You can use this CSS code to make them closer. Insert this CSS code in Dashboard > Forums > Settings > Styles > Custom CSS Code textarea, save it, delete all caches, go to forum front-end and press Ctrl+F5:

#wpforo #wpforo-wrap .wpfpm-msg-inner p {
     margin-bottom: 7px;
}

One more issue, not sure if this was caused by the above code. But on the posts, they look like they have too much space (leading) now. Space after and before paragraphs are fine, but the actual line leading is too much. See attached sample of a post page:

https://www.writersofthefuture.com/forum/the-contest-quarterly-topics-and-other-items/wotf-forum-upgrade/paged/2/#post-36497

Is this related to the CSS I just added or do I need to use another CSS to adjust the leading?

@jason-toth

the space comes from your WP theme

add this CSS Code (Custom CSS)

#wpforo #wpforo-wrap .wpforo-post-content p {
    line-height: 20px !important;
}
